Onboarding — Night Shift, Tarnwell Logistics Hub. Badge migration to the Ferrex system completes Friday. Old grey fobs stop working at 22:00 Thursday. Collect your new badge from the security pod before shift start. Tap twice at turnstiles during the changeover week; single tap after. If the Ferrex reader shows amber, enter the fallback pass shown below.

staff pass of kawip-hawef = bdg-QLP-2

## Runbook: Chip reader hiccups

If the Stridemark timing-chip readers at the Fernloch Marathon start missing reads, don't panic — it's usually the mat buffer filling up. Restart the relay with `stridemark-relay restart`, then watch the split feed for a minute. Plugin authors: your hooks fire after dedup, so duplicate pings are expected upstream. To replay missed reads, the relay pulls from the results store using the following.

primary connection of yagep-kahip = redis://giliel_svc:zYiKsLL2PLpfPL@db-348f.xolmarsys.corp:5432/fenwyn

## Tuning

FeeCrafter's rules engine decides shipping fees per order, and yes, the defaults are opinionated. If a merchant on the Parcelgrove plan complains about weird surcharges, it's almost always one of the knobs below rather than a bug. Changing a value takes effect on the next rule reload, so no restart needed — just don't crank the distance multiplier without checking with eng. Current defaults follow.

tuning table, kageg-kagap:
CAPS = {
    "druox": 842,
    "quenax": 605,
    "zormir": 107,
    "tamwyn": 577,
    "kasok": 688,
}

**Session Refresh Bug — Summary for Sync**

Tokens issued by Gatehouse were refreshing twice when two tabs raced, invalidating the first session. Fix adds a refresh lock with a short grace window so concurrent requests reuse the new token. Values were validated against the Pellman staging cluster under load. Proposed constants for the lock and grace window follow.

tuning table, kajog-kawef:
PRIORITIES = {
    "kelox": 870,
    "kasix": 89,
    "eliax": 988,
}